Thats not the point. The point is the situation we now find ourselves in at center. With no upgrades on the FA market, we now have two options: move someone on the roster to center who is completely unproven there, or draft a rookie with our early pick and hope he's plug and play.

We should have gotten aggressive this FA and signed one of the MANY good interior options out there. We chose Floyd. The issue is center was by far the weakest part of the OL for 2 years now and we didn't aggressively make moves to improve it. And guess what, there is a legit decent chance whoever plays center in 2021 is WORSE than Blythe. People aren't thinking about that possibility but its real.
